vscode-agent-todos: позвольте агентам читать и управлять TODO в коде
vscode-agent-todos, созданный Digitarald, соединяет AI-агентов и рабочие процессы разработчиков, предоставляя машинным системам маркеры задач в коде. Инструмент предлагает программный интерфейс, чтобы помощники могли находить, добавлять и обновлять задачи на основе комментариев внутри рабочего пространства VS Code, используя Протокол Контекста Модели. Он подчеркивает поддержку тегов и постоянное состояние агента, что делает его подходящим для инженеров, которые внедряют агентное отслеживание задач в свои существующие рабочие процессы кодирования.
Для каких задач вы можете его использовать?
Инструмент сосредоточен на управлении задачами на основе комментариев. Он сканирует рабочее пространство на наличие комментариев TODO, позволяет агенту создавать новые записи задач и отмечать элементы как завершенные, поддерживая фильтры по пути, ключевому слову или приоритету. Эти действия позволяют помощнику поддерживать простой жизненный цикл задач, связанный с исходными файлами, так что агенты могут отслеживать технический долг и незавершенную работу непосредственно там, где находится код.
Насколько точны и надежны выводы, видимые агенту?
Выводы отражают содержимое ваших файлов и команды агента. Поскольку сервер открывает существующие комментарии и записывает новые в рабочее пространство, прозрачность высокая: то, что сообщает агент, соответствует фактическому тексту комментариев или местоположению файлов. Надежность зависит от чистоты комментариев в кодовой базе; редкие или непоследовательные маркеры TODO снижают полезность списков задач, полученных от агента.
Какие входные данные и окружение он требует?
Инструмент работает как сервер Node.js MCP и нуждается в хосте MCP и VS Code. Установка обычно выполняется с помощью npm, а конфигурация происходит внутри настроек хоста MCP, например, с помощью Claude Desktop. Сервер работает на локальной файловой системе внутри рабочего пространства VS Code, поэтому доступ к хосту MCP и рабочему пространству является предварительным условием для активности агента.
Требует ли он технической настройки или постоянного обслуживания?
Принятие благоприятно для разработчиков, комфортно работающих с локальными инструментами. Реализация описывается как легковесная и открытая, что поддерживает инспекцию и расширение, но настройка требует знаний Node.js и конфигурации MCP. Команды, использующие агентские рабочие процессы, получают наибольшую ценность; менее техническим командам может понадобиться помощь в настройке хостов и предоставлении соответствующих разрешений на файловую систему.
Практично для команд разработчиков с поддержкой агентов, но узконаправленно
vscode-agent-todos является практичным вариантом для команд разработчиков, создающих агентские рабочие процессы задач, поскольку он интегрируется с хостами MCP и записывает состояние задач в рабочую область. Его полезность ограничена средами, которые уже запускают совместимые с MCP хосты и предоставляют доступ к локальным файлам, поэтому команды без этой инфраструктуры видят мало пользы. Ожидайте, что он подойдет для проектов, которые хотят, чтобы агенты управляли TODO-заметками, связанными с кодом, оставаясь при этом подотчетными и расширяемыми.
Pros
Экспонирует задачи в коде через Протокол Контекста Модели
Поддерживает создание, обновление и фильтрацию комментариев TODO
Реализация Node.js открыта и легко проверяется
Интегрируется с MCP хостами, такими как Claude Desktop
Cons
Требуется хост MCP и VS Code для работы
Полагается на разрешения файловой системы, предоставленные серверу
Сосредоточен на задачах, основанных на комментариях, а не на широких изменениях кода
Законы, касающиеся использования этого программного обеспечения, варьируются от страны к стране. Мы не поощряем и не одобряем использование этой программы, если она нарушает эти законы. Softonic может получить реферальное вознаграждение, если вы перейдете по ссылке или купите и продукты, представленные здесь.